When calculating the cost of a long-distance move, several key factors come into play. The total weight of your belongings and the physical distance between your current home and your new destination are the primary drivers. Additionally, the complexity of the move—such as needing professional packing services, handling stairs or tight turns, or requiring storage—will shift the total. Interstate companies are specialized to move household goods between two or more states. They handle the inventory checks and transit logistics required for long hauls across the country. You need this service if you are making a major life change that takes you over state lines. They offer the necessary tracking and safety protocols to protect your goods during the long journey.
